yes indeed, this is directly accessible within ABINIT.
You can look at the following papers :

*** for the formalism related to IR reflectivity spectra :

- X. Gonze and C. Lee,
PHYSICAL REVIEW B 55, 10355 (1997).

and Raman spectra :

- Nonlinear optical susceptibilities, Raman efficiencies, and electro-optic tensors
from first-principles density functional perturbation theory
M. Veithen, X. Gonze, and Ph. Ghosez
PHYSICAL REVIEW B 71, 125107 (2005)

*** for applications on different types of systems look for instance at :

- Theoretical determination of the Raman spectra of MgSiO3 perovskite
and post-perovskite at high pressure
Caracas R, Cohen, E
GEOPHYSICAL RESEARCH LETTERS   33,   L12S05   (2006)

- Raman spectra and lattice dynamics of cubic gauche nitrogen
Caracas R
JOURNAL OF CHEMICAL PHYSICS   127 , 144510   (2007)

- First-principles calculations of the nonlinear optical susceptibilities and Raman
scattering spectra of lithium niobate
P Hermet, M Veithen and Ph Ghosez
J. Phys.: Condens. Matter 19 (2007) 456202

- Raman and infrared spectra of multiferroic bismuth ferrite from first principles
P. Hermet, M. Goffinet, J. Kreisel, and Ph. Ghosez
PHYSICAL REVIEW B 75, 220102 R (2007)

- Raman Scattering in Crystalline Oligothiophenes: A Comparison between Density
Functional Theory and Bond Polarizability Model
P. Hermet, N. Izard, A. Rahmani, and Ph. Ghosez
J. Phys. Chem. B 2006, 110, 24869-24875

For more examples you should certyainly search also for more papers by
Razvan CARACAS.
